/*! Transport Protocol Data Unit (TPDU) sub-states of ISO7816_S_IN_TPDU
* @note defined in ISO/IEC 7816-3:2006(E) section 10 and 12
* @remark APDUs are formed by one or more command+response TPDUs
*/
enum tpdu_sniff_state {
TPDU_S_CLA, /*!< class byte */
TPDU_S_INS, /*!< instruction byte */
TPDU_S_P1, /*!< first parameter byte for the instruction */
TPDU_S_P2, /*!< second parameter byte for the instruction */
TPDU_S_P3, /*!< third parameter byte encoding the data length */
TPDU_S_PROCEDURE, /*!< procedure byte (could also be SW1) */
TPDU_S_DATA_REMAINING, /*!< remaining data bytes */
TPDU_S_DATA_SINGLE, /*!< single data byte */
TPDU_S_SW1, /*!< first status word */
TPDU_S_SW2, /*!< second status word */
};

static void process_byte_tpdu(uint8_t byte)
{
/* sanity check */
if (ISO7816_S_IN_TPDU!=iso_state) {
TRACE_ERROR("Processing TPDU data in wrong ISO 7816-3 state %u\n\r", iso_state);
return;
}
if (tpdu_packet_i>=ARRAY_SIZE(tpdu_packet)) {
TRACE_ERROR("TPDU data overflow\n\r");
return;
}
/* handle TPDU byte depending on current state */
switch (tpdu_state) {
case TPDU_S_CLA:
if (0xff==byte) {
TRACE_WARNING("0xff is not a valid class byte\n\r");
break;
}
tpdu_packet_i = 0;
tpdu_packet[tpdu_packet_i++] = byte;
tpdu_state = TPDU_S_INS;
break;
case TPDU_S_INS:
tpdu_packet_i = 1;
tpdu_packet[tpdu_packet_i++] = byte;
tpdu_state = TPDU_S_P1;
break;
case TPDU_S_P1:
tpdu_packet_i = 2;
tpdu_packet[tpdu_packet_i++] = byte;
tpdu_state = TPDU_S_P2;
break;
case TPDU_S_P2:
tpdu_packet_i = 3;
tpdu_packet[tpdu_packet_i++] = byte;
tpdu_state = TPDU_S_P3;
break;
case TPDU_S_P3:
tpdu_packet_i = 4;
tpdu_packet[tpdu_packet_i++] = byte;
tpdu_state = TPDU_S_PROCEDURE;
break;
case TPDU_S_PROCEDURE:
if (0x60==byte) { /* wait for next procedure byte */
break;
} else if (tpdu_packet[1]==byte) { /* get all remaining data bytes */
tpdu_state = TPDU_S_DATA_REMAINING;
break;
} else if ((~tpdu_packet[1])==byte) { /* get single data byte */
tpdu_state = TPDU_S_DATA_SINGLE;
break;
}
case TPDU_S_SW1:
if ((0x60==(byte&0xf0)) || (0x90==(byte&0xf0))) { /* this procedure byte is SW1 */
tpdu_packet[tpdu_packet_i++] = byte;
tpdu_state = TPDU_S_SW2;
} else {
TRACE_WARNING("invalid SW1 0x%02x\n\r", byte);
}
break;
case TPDU_S_SW2:
tpdu_packet[tpdu_packet_i++] = byte;
print_tpdu(); /* print TPDU for info */
change_state(ISO7816_S_WAIT_TPDU); /* this is the end of the TPDU */
break;
case TPDU_S_DATA_SINGLE:
case TPDU_S_DATA_REMAINING:
tpdu_packet[tpdu_packet_i++] = byte;
if (0==tpdu_packet[4]) {
if (5+256<=tpdu_packet_i) {
tpdu_state = TPDU_S_SW1;
}
} else {
if (5+tpdu_packet[4]<=tpdu_packet_i) {
tpdu_state = TPDU_S_SW1;
}
}
if (TPDU_S_DATA_SINGLE==tpdu_state) {
tpdu_state = TPDU_S_PROCEDURE;
}
break;
default:
TRACE_ERROR("unhandled TPDU state %u\n\r", tpdu_state);
}
}
